Output 2b7fa0217578c8fa5f850c3fb477603625184edec7ec7646ce9ad43a0f51370d:4

value
577603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c0be0fb6b6d1ab2013a60aba40adb0f77f7e08 OP_EQUAL
address
3MuY9v8hy1JEiEtMBjsDyTvziPsoamnq9Z
transaction
2b7fa0217578c8fa5f850c3fb477603625184edec7ec7646ce9ad43a0f51370d
confirmations
264112
spent
true